di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ml
index 58602d296056e4c8fe131baf29252df9fa4c0d1f..d10b17a3d2fcfbb3410695468a2a01da6e1ca3c3 100644
--- a/.gitlab-ci.yml
+++ b/.gitlab-ci.yml
@@ -80,6 +80,20 @@ docker_develop:
   tags:
     - dind
 
+build_api:
+  # Simply publish a zip containing api/ directory
+  stage: deploy
+  image: busybox
+  artifacts:
+    name: "api_${CI_COMMIT_REF_NAME}"
+    paths:
+      - api
+  only:
+    - tags
+    - master
+    - develop
+
+
 docker_release:
   stage: deploy
   before_script: